Summary: Good for the Beginner
Comment: This 1995 publication by Dorling Kindersley has the hallmarks of DK publications, large glossy pages, interesting details, and high quality color pictures. However, because it focuses on developing basketball skills, there are few of the archival photos, sidebars, and memorabilia that DK usually presents. Basketball history is limited, and there are very few shots of NBA players.

Instead the book gives a thorough presentation of fundamental basketball skills, including dribbling, several types of passing and shooting, defense, and some plays such as the fast break, the give and go, and the screen play. Young models illustrate these basics and the presentation is very clear. Again, however, this is a book for beginning players, those with some experience playing on a supervised team will probably not benefit that much from this material.
